UW-Madison Arboretum designated as National Historic Landmark


UW-Madison Arboretum designated as National Historic Landmark
February 2, 2021 11:18 AM
Jaymes Langrehr
Updated:
MADISON, Wis. UW-Madison says its Arboretum is now being recognized as a National Historic Landmark.
UW-Madison says the Arboretum earned the designation for a “period of national significance” that stretches from the 1930s to the 1960s in which the first forest plantings were made and experiments were conducted to study the ecosystem.
Getting recognized as a National Historic Landmark involves a long nomination process before the nomination is evaluated by the National Park Service’s National Historic Landmark Survey and reviewed by the National Park System Advisory Board. A recommendation is then sent to the Secretary of the Interior, who eventually makes the final decision. ....

UW–Madison Arboretum designated a National Historic Landmark


UW–Madison Arboretum designated a National Historic Landmark

Curtis Prairie, seen from the Wisconsin Native Plant Garden, is regarded as the oldest restored prairie in the world. UW–Madison Arboretum
The University of Wisconsin–Madison Arboretum has been designated as a National Historic Landmark by the National Park Service. The designation is based on the Arboretum’s pioneering work in restoration ecology, its place in the history of conservation, and its commitment to Aldo Leopold’s land ethic.
The UW–Madison Arboretum was established in the 1930s as an outdoor laboratory to study how to repair damaged and degraded landscapes.
